I remembered when I tried correcting a driver on this thread, some lashed out at me.
Let me give few tips...
1. Greeting your rider should be a must, if your rider replies or not shouldn't be your business.
If your rider replies, good...
2. Take little things into consideration. There are things you can't really control, such as nature. When your rider isn't comfortable, maybe he or she got cold, catarrh, sneezing/coughing, it's wise to show a bit of care, offer a wipe to use, ask if he or she needs water to drink, 50/100naira from your pocket won't kill you.
3. Don't start a conversation except your rider initiates it, if your rider initiates it, know how to maintain professionalism.

4. Use a mild body spray and airfreshner.

Before you rush to invest in a car, I would suggest you slow down a bit.

It is possible to get a car on rental, so you can test the platform if it will work for you or not.

Don't spend all your life saving on a car because some expenses would follow which if not attended to immediately would frustrate your decision.

Yeah, you can buy a Naija Used car but please don't buy an abused car.

If possible, settle for a Hydunai Elantra or Corolla (If you have a secured environment) and please if possible but from vehicle first user. The user must buy the car new.

If you buy a naija used car that the first user bought as tokunbo, Gazzuzz garage would be your favourite destinations after the purchase grin cheesy grin

Finding your way in Lagos is very easy, just be polite, friendly and open-minded and watch as your riders gladly direct your path in Lagos.

Best of luck my brother.

Before you buy, have a good unbiased mechanic inspect the car.

Make sure you have enough for "Change of Ownership" and Comprehensive Insurance.

Also take time to study if it would be economical to maintain the car after purchase.


Spolier Alert - Kia don't have a good second hand value.
